IndyMac Federal Savings Bank, FSB, appeals a final summary judgment dismissing its foreclosure claim against Frank Nabozny based on the court's conclusion that the bank's notice of default letter did not comply with the requirements of the mortgage. We conclude that IndyMac's letter substantially complied with its notice obligations under the mortgage terms and thus was sufficient. See Green Tree Servicing, LLC v. Milam, 40 Fla. L. Weekly D1733 (Fla. 2d DCA July 29, 2015). Accordingly, we reverse the summary judgment and remand for further proceedings. Reversed and remanded. LaROSE and SALARIO, JJ., Concur. -2-
